The Center for Afrofuturist Studies Founded in 2015, the Center for Afrofuturist Studies is a residency program for artists of color based in Iowa City.

The Center for Afrofuturist Studies (CAS) is an initiative to re-imagine the futures of marginalized peoples by generating dynamic work-spaces for artists of color. Dynamic means interactive, supportive, community-engaged, rigorous, and inclusive. Curated by Anaïs Duplan, the CAS hosts artists-in-residence and produces lectures, workshops, public forums, and exhibitions in collaboration with artists on the intersections of race, technology, and the diaspora.
